The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in London with a requirement for ISO/IEC 27001 sk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ited ISO/IEC 27001 over the 6 months to 20 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
20 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 177 174 298
Rank change year-on-year -3 +124 -29
Permanent jobs citing ISO/IEC 27001 436 691 998
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in London 1.84% 2.05% 1.42%
As % of the Quality Assurance & Compliance category 13.03% 12.41% 8.71%
Number of salaries quoted 397 442 652
10th Percentile £47,500 £36,250 £45,000
25th Percentile £52,500 £50,000 £52,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£72,500 £65,000 £66,123
Median % change year-on-year +11.54% -1.70% -2.04%
75th Percentile £87,500 £85,000 £82,500
90th Percentile £99,250 £97,500 £97,500
England median annual salary £60,000 £60,000 £60,000
